  Nutrition and Food Science International Journal Abstract The consumption of energy drinks is experiencing a sharp increase in the world as in Benin with a flourishing market. Many questions remain as to their composition and their potential health effects. Although their composition varies depending on the brand. The substances most encountered in these drinks are caffeine, taurine, group B vitamins, sugars, and derivatives. Several cases of caffeine intoxication have been reported by US poison control centers following the consumption of these energy drinks. These facts, despite their seriousness, however, remain poorly documented. We have undertaken through the present study, the identification, and the assay by liquid chromatography UV-visible of caffeine in 34 samples of energy drinks collected in 15 supermarkets of Cotonou in Benin Republic after some preliminary tests of visual inspection, measurements of the beverage volume and pH.                     Nutrition and Food Science International Journal Abstract Background:  Cooking salt is widely used to provide iodine to humans. In Benin, the production of salt is still artisanal. Our study focused on salt produced in Sèmè-Kpodji, a secondary site of local salt production in Benin, and on the availability of iodine in salt in this municipality. Methods:  The descriptive cross-sectional study included exhaustive salt producers and randomly selected households in Sèmè-Kpodji. Direct observation was made to describe salt production. In household, a standard questionnaire collected data about the physical characteristic of salt used. Iodine content was determined with the MBI kit and by the iodometric titration method.   Nutrition and food science international journal - Juniper Publishers Abstract Background: Pandanus conoideus Lamk (Red fruit) is a Papuan traditional food which has been used to treat various diseases. Despite these various effects of Red fruit, little is known about the physiological mechanism. Aims: The aim of this study was to investigate the anti-inflammatory properties of Red fruit oil (RFO) and establish the signal pathway of leading compounds. Methods: Raw 264.7 murine macrophage cells were used with lipopolysaccharide (LPS). Cell viability and the pro-inflammatory factors were investigated using MTT assay, real time PCR, western blot analysis, and Enzyme linked immuno-sorbent assay (ELISA). The quantification of leading compounds in RFO was performed using high performance liquid chromatography (HPLC). Results: RFO did not affect cell viability.
